The ingredients needed to make Quaker Oats Vanishing Oatmeal Rasin Cookies:
- Take 1 3/4 sticks butter, softened
- Make ready 3/4 cup firmly packed brown sugar
- Prepare 1/2 cup granulated sugar
- Prepare 2 eggs
- Prepare 1 tsp vanilla
- Prepare 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
- Prepare 1 tsp baking soda
- Make ready 1 tsp cinnamon
- Take 1/2 tsp salt (optional)
- Get 1 cup raisins
- Get 3 cups Quaker Oats Old Fashion uncooked oats

Steps to make Quaker Oats Vanishing Oatmeal Rasin Cookies:
- Heat oven to 350 degrees. In a large bowl, beat butter and sugars together on medium speed of an electric mixer until creamy.
- Add eggs and vanilla; beat well.
- Add combined flour, baking soda, cinnamon and salt. Mix well.
- Add oats and raisins; mix well.
- Form dough by rounding tablespoonfuls onto a greased cookie sheets. Bake 8-10 minutes or until light golden brown.
- Cool 1 minute on cookie sheets. Remove to wire rack. Cool completely. Store tightly covered.
